Comprehensive plan addendum is an additional document that supplements a comprehensive plan with new or updated information.
Entities or individuals responsible for creating and updating the comprehensive plan are required to file the addendum.
To fill out a comprehensive plan addendum, gather the necessary information and follow the instructions provided by the governing authority.
The purpose of a comprehensive plan addendum is to ensure that the comprehensive plan remains current and reflects any changes or developments in the community.
The information reported on a comprehensive plan addendum may include updates on population growth, land use changes, infrastructure improvements, and economic development projects.
